Transaction 84af80bcdcd8718bfa67da90248506d5d9b381a61669e96cc5ecb6b6862d0bfb
1 Input
1 Output
-
84af80bcdcd8718bfa67da90248506d5d9b381a61669e96cc5ecb6b6862d0bfb:0
- value
- 2854289
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 377966b7cca72be1bff400e12c382cd09a440f77 OP_EQUALVERIFY OP_CHECKSIG
- address
- 164Kbf6e2fzgp1AQZ76zcXDrJC9yNXYrc2